自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(23)
  • 资源 (1)
  • 收藏
  • 关注

原创 多机器人编队人工势场法协同避障算法原理及实现

ROS及SLAM进阶教程(十一)多机器人编队人工势场法协同避障算法原理及实现避障算法原理避障算法仿真多机器人协同编队需要将理论和实践紧密地结合起来,其应用包括编队队形生成、保持、变换和路径规划与避障等等都是基于图论的理论基础完成的。详细请参考ROS及SLAM进阶教程(八)多机器人协同编队算法原理及实现自主避障功能是机器人编队在各种环境中保持自身安全的重要功能,在编队的基础上加入避障的功能,机器人可扫描到一定范围内的障碍物(包括其他机器人),在即将与之发生冲突时提前规避冲突,以保证自身的安全性,同时

2020-05-21 09:37:13 16724 26

原创 多机器人协同编队算法原理及实现

ROS及SLAM进阶教程(八)机器人协同编队算法原理及实现图论基础基于一致性的编队控制算法编队控制算法原理编队算法仿真实现多机器人协同编队需要将理论和实践紧密地结合起来,其应用包括编队队形生成、保持、变换和路径规划与避障等等都是基于图论的理论基础完成的。图论基础控制协同多智能体动态系统是通过通信图进行相互联系的动力学问题,通信图表明了各个节点之间的信息流。协同控制的目标是为各个节点设计控制协...

2020-04-24 17:22:04 27605 48

原创 示例及详解:MATLAB多机器人协同编队训练与学习的简单实现

作者在读学校Singapore University of Technology and DesignEstablished under strong support from MIT, Singapore University of Technology and Design (SUTD) plans to do for Singapore what MIT has done for Massachusetts and Silicon Valley, as well as for the world.

2021-10-24 10:03:36 10934

原创 示例及详解:MATLAB实现多机器人协同编队动态仿真

作者在读学校Singapore University of Technology and DesignEstablished under strong support from MIT, Singapore University of Technology and Design (SUTD) plans to do for Singapore what MIT has done for Massachusetts and Silicon Valley, as well as for the world.

2021-06-10 15:35:15 8775 13

原创 放弃北大医学院、清华定向生选择了上海交大,五年后我后悔吗

一点都不后悔2020年是特殊的一年,高考即将到来,相信不少家长朋友都将面临选择专业和学校的问题,在这里我将分享自己的经历。2015年的夏天是属于我们这一届的高考毕业季,也是收获季。一起奋斗过、哭过笑过、低谷过、风光过的高中生活对我们来说结束了,我们面对的是全新的开始。在2015年6月24日晚上,由于全省前一千名提前公布,我知道了自己的排名,考的很好但也没用很激动,因为那个排名非常尴尬——在清华北大本科一批录取线的边缘,加上我们那年本科一批的名额变少,我大概率无法获得一批录取,但是可供我选择的还有北大

2020-06-26 22:45:03 3276 6

原创 从概率论角度解释COVID-19的检测为什么一般是两次

经典的概率论问题(二)稀有疾病的检测前言例题介绍及解答后记本系列是博主为了督促自己在博士期间能够静下心来完成科研开设,并将我在学习期间学到的知识通过自己的语言讲解出来,如果能帮到你那么再好不过。前言COVID-19已经被发现了半年之久,并且其深深影响了人们的生活习惯和生活方式。在疫情前期,大家都非常在意确诊人数、疑似人数这些数字的变化,在关注重点从国内转移到国外时,国外的确诊人数呈指数型上升,最明显的是美国,连续多日新增确诊人数上万,英国在宣布放弃群体免疫策略之后确诊人数也是大幅上升,日本在宣布

2020-06-04 17:00:35 1739 9

原创 蒙提霍尔问题探讨

经典的概率论问题(一)蒙提霍尔问题探讨蒙提霍尔问题蒙题霍尔问题的正解蒙题霍尔问题的误解问题扩展本系列是博主为了督促自己在博士期间能够静下心来完成科研开设,并将我在学习期间学到的知识通过自己的语言讲解出来,如果能帮到你那么再好不过。蒙提霍尔问题在蒙提霍尔主持的电视节目“Let’s Make a Deal”中,参赛选手可以首先从三个关闭的门中选择一个门,其中三个门后依次有两只山羊、一辆轿车,如果选择到轿车则可以获得该车。只有蒙提霍尔本人知道哪扇门后面是轿车,在选手选择后,蒙提霍尔会在剩的两个门中挑出一

2020-06-04 16:08:21 1415 1

原创 ROS包源码安装与二进制安装的问题

ROS及SLAM进阶教程(十)ROS包源码安装与二进制安装的问题两者的区别如何更改默认包两者的区别二进制包是直接通过apt方式安装了ROS相关的软件包,而我们在GitHub上下载自己需要的源码来进行代码复用,编译通过生成可运行节点后的包是源码包,两者是可以共存的,但是运行时只能运行bash/zsh文件中默认环境下的包。二进制包安装便捷,只需要sudo指令即可,如sudo apt-get install ros-kinetic-PACAKGE而源码包的安装需要使用git指令,如$ cd catk

2020-05-13 16:32:20 1555 1

原创 如何写好一篇论文-02

读博随笔(六)如何写好一篇论文-02 博士生的写作tips论文组织结构摘要(Abstract)和引言(Introduction)文献综述(Literature review)文章主体结论(Conclusions)与附录(Appendices)写作要点保持简短通用的观点脚注表格(Table)和图表(Figure)语句小技巧一些细节本系列是博主为了督促自己在博士期间能够静下心来完成科研开设,并将我...

2020-05-01 15:51:55 748

原创 Gmapping+amcl的turtlebot实现和Gazebo仿真实现

ROS及SLAM进阶教程(九)Gmapping的turtlebot实现和Gazebo仿真实现安装雷达驱动和gmapping制作雷达驱动文件测试激光雷达 gmapping 构建地图利用地图进行amcl导航Gazebo下的实现Gmapping包提供了基于激光雷达的SLAM的方法,你可以通过一个移动机器人的激光雷达数据和位置数据来创建一个2D的栅格地图。For more information, ...

2020-04-27 10:16:38 2729 3

原创 如何高效记笔记

适合各阶段的学习干货(一)如何高效记笔记笔记的作用高中阶段如何记笔记高中笔记该怎么使用?考研笔记笔者本科毕业于上海交大,生源地河南,初中高中形成了一套高效有用的学习方法,高考理综全市第十,数学147全市第四。曾经参加了2018年考研,三个月时间初试在没发挥好的情况下总分超过380,三个月的时间又印证了之前学习方法的有效性。于是在这里我将此前学习期间的感悟或者心得记录下来,如果能帮到你那么再...

2020-04-24 10:12:55 717

原创 ROS常用包指令操作总结

ROS及SLAM进阶教程(七)ROS常用Package、Bag、Node、Topic、Service等指令操作Package相关操作Node相关操作Topic相关操作Service相关操作bag相关操作相信大家在编译运行某个节点文件经常会出现节点文件无法被找到的情况,或者在运行时不知道文件的位置、不知道该如何监听数据来进行调试等问题,为了方便大家更熟悉ROS的操作,同时方便大家的调试,本次更新一...

2020-04-23 09:42:59 1081

原创 ROS Turtlebot2驱动安装

ROS及SLAM进阶教程(六)ROS Turtlebot2驱动安装二进制安装Turtlebot2源码安装建立工作空间设置环境变量测试TurtlebotTurtlebot驱动是运行turtlebot机器人的必备文件,很多同学想要更改一些参数却找不到文件包,那就是安装的方法或者对包的理解不够。二进制安装sudo apt-get install ros-kinetic-turtlebot ros-...

2020-04-21 17:36:27 1221

原创 如何写好一篇论文-01

读博随笔(五)如何写好一篇论文-01 七个简单实用的建议不要等待:动笔就写明确你的核心idea讲好一个故事把你的论文贡献钉牢相关研究:放在后面读者第一听取读者的意见总结本系列是博主为了督促自己在博士期间能够静下心来完成科研开设,并将我在学习期间的感悟或者心得记录下来,如果能帮到你那么再好不过。Note:本系列有三篇 如何写好一篇论文 是博主在阅读John H. Cochrane的Writi...

2020-04-21 14:34:56 835

原创 如何做好学术演讲-02

读博随笔(四)如何做好学术演讲-02序言学术演讲的目的你的观众该讲些什么你该忽略掉什么学术演讲现场结论本系列是博主为了督促自己在博士期间能够静下心来完成科研开设,并将我在学习期间的感悟或者心得记录下来,如果能帮到你那么再好不过。Note:本系列两篇 如何做好学术演讲 是博主在阅读Jonathan Shewchuk的Giving an Academic Talk一文以及观看Simon Pey...

2020-04-19 13:58:22 449

原创 如何做好学术演讲-01

读博随笔(三)如何做一个好的学术演讲A本系列是博主为了督促自己在博士期间能够静下心来完成科研开设,并将我在学习期间的感悟或者心得记录下来,如果能帮到你那么再好不过。博主系上海交通大学2019届本科毕业生,2019/07-2020/06期间从事机器人SLAM工作一年,并将于2020/09到新加坡读取博士学位。本系列读博随笔为了督促自己在博士期间能够静下心来完成科研开设,并将我在学习期间的...

2020-04-18 17:09:23 635 4

原创 论文如何更大概率地通过审稿人的review/准确地评估一篇论文的价值

读博随笔(二)论文如何更大概率地通过审稿人的review/准确地评估一篇论文的价值本系列是博主为了督促自己在博士期间能够静下心来完成科研开设,并将我在学习期间的感悟或者心得记录下来,如果能帮到你那么再好不过。Note:该篇文章是笔者看了Boi Faltings所分享的How to write a review讲座课件,从中节选自己的心得分享给大家,希望大家能仔细耐心并反复阅读,一定在科研之...

2020-04-17 16:57:06 592

翻译 如何高效阅读一篇论文

读博随笔(一)如何高效阅读一篇论文本系列是博主为了督促自己在博士期间能够静下心来完成科研开设,并将我在学习期间的感悟或者心得记录下来,如果能帮到你那么再好不过。Note:该篇文章翻译自William G. Griswold所分享的How to Read an Engineering Research Paper一文由于论文页数的限制以及大部分的阅读者都比较了解相关领域的知识了,所以论文都...

2020-04-16 14:35:07 846

原创 Movebase使用小结

ROS进阶教程(四)Movebase使用小结博主有两年多ROS的使用经验,目前仍在不停研究中。本系列ROS及SLAM进阶教程将涵盖ROS的进阶功能使用、机器人SLAM及导航的设计及研究等领域,持续不断更新中。如果大家有相关问题或发现作者漏洞欢迎私戳,同时欢迎关注收藏。同时欢迎关注博主Git:https://github.com/redglassli...

2020-04-14 14:37:48 6059 10

原创 Movebase之FTC局部规划器详解

ROS进阶教程(五)Movebase之FTC局部规划器详解博主有两年多ROS的使用经验,目前仍在不停研究中。本系列ROS及SLAM进阶教程将涵盖ROS的进阶功能使用、机器人SLAM及导航的设计及研究等领域,持续不断更新中。如果大家有相关问题或发现作者漏洞欢迎私戳,同时欢迎关注收藏。同时欢迎关注博主Git:https://github.com/redglassli...

2020-04-14 10:49:44 2806 4

原创 AMCL源码架构讲解与详细分析

ROS里踩过的坑(三)AMCL源码分析AMCL算法简介AMCL包结构与通信CmakeLists研究体系结构与研究节点文件函数讲解订阅话题函数发布话题函数发布服务函数main函数库函数功能简介sensorsmappfAMCL算法简介AMCL包结构与通信CmakeLists研究体系结构与研究节点文件函数讲解订阅话题函数发布话题函数发布服务函数main函数库函数功能简介sensor...

2020-04-14 10:01:28 5976 2

原创 AMCL算法原理讲解

ROS进阶教程(二)AMCL算法原理讲解AMCL算法理解蒙特卡洛定位算法蒙特卡洛定位算法自适应变种里程计运动模型测距仪模型波束模型似然域模型AMCL算法理解AMCL(adaptive Monte Carlo Localization)自适应蒙特卡洛定位 ,源于MCL算法的一种增强,那么为什么要从MCL升级为AMCL呢?首先应该了解MCL的算法原理本教程是对Dr. Sebastian Thr...

2020-04-13 16:48:13 17494 8

原创 Gazebo仿真平台模型搭建与修改

ROS里踩过的坑(一)Gazebo仿真平台模型搭建与修改文件讲解Models 文件World文件Launch文件模型编辑可视化编辑配置文件编辑模型展示如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出...

2020-04-13 14:51:19 10531 14

多机器人编队及避障仿真算法.zip

该算法包在MATLAB中仿真实现了多机器人协同编队算法及基于人工势场法的避障算法,用户可基于该仿真算法开发和验证各种协同算法及避障算法 注:本算法没有main函数,大家在解压后可直接运行consensus_1.m或者formaion_avo开头的几个.m文件,在运行的时候要将文件中的subfun文件夹导入到Matlab中作为子函数,具体导入方法可自行百度。如出现运行错误提示函数缺失就是没有将函数导入到里面。 对于评论区的无脑评论和评星大家请忽视,那是之前没有给出具体的使用说明

2020-04-13

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除